Elected Members of the DC State Board of Education to Be Sworn In

Friday, May 13, 2011
The new members were elected to vacant seats in Wards 4 and 8.

(Washington, DC) – Two newly elected members to the DC State Board of Education will be sworn in at 5:30 pm on May 18, 2011, at a ceremony to be held in the Old Council Chambers at Judiciary Square shortly before the monthly scheduled Board Public Meeting.

The new members were elected to the State Board seats in a special election held to fill the terms remaining on two vacant seats for the District of Columbia Wards 4 and 8.

The new members, D. Kamili Anderson was elected to the Ward 4 seat vacated by Sekou Biddle who was appointed to fill the At Large Council seat vacated by the current Council Chair, Kwame Brown. Trayon White was elected to the Ward 8 seat that became vacant at the untimely passing of William Lockridge late last year.

The Honorable Muriel Bowser, Council member of the District of Columbia for Ward 4, and the Honorable Marion Barry, former Council Chair and current Council member of the District of Columbia for Ward 8 will be performing the Oath of Office for each member respectively.
